P r e s e n t l y , t h e r e is no g e n e r a l l y accepted, a n d s a t i s f a c t o r y t h e o r y t h a t c a n e x p l a i n s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s in p u b l i c b u d g e t s o v e r time. M o s t of the e x i s t i n g a p p r o a c h e s , for e x a m p l e , b y W a g n e r (1911) a n d his l a w of e x p a n d i n g g o v e r n m e n t a c t i v i t i e s , b y T i m m (1961) a n d his l a g - t h e o r y , or b y P e a c o c k a n d W i s e m a n

(1961) a n d t h e i r d i s p l a c e m e n t e f f e c t of g o v e r n m e n t e x p e n d i ­ t u r e s d u r i n g p e r i o d s of c r i s e s , a r e p r i m a r i l y c o n c e r n e d w i t h e x p l a n a t i o n s o f the l o n g - t e r m g r o w t h of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e

1

a n d its s h a r e of n a t i o n a l i n c o m e a n d o n l y s e c o n d a r i l y c o n c e r n e d w i t h the a n a l y s i s o f s h o r t - r u n a n d i n t e r m e d i a t e s t r u c t u r a l d e v e l o p m e n t s o f p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s in the c o n t e x t o f c h a n g e s in i n d i v i d u a l e x p e n d i t u r e s c o m p o n e n t s in r e l a t i o n to the t o t a l b u d g e t (for a n e x c e l l e n t s u r v e y see: R e c k t e n w a l d

1977) .

In c o n t r a s t to t h e s e l o n g - r u n a p p r o a c h e s , t h e r e are some s h o r t - r u n c o n c e p t s a v a i l a b l e too, w h i c h e x p l a i n t h e s h o r t - r u n r e l a t i v e c o n s t a n c y of t h e b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e , n a m e l y , the c o n ­ c e p t of i n c r e m e n t a l i s m . L i n d b l o m (1959) d e v e l o p e d t h i s c o n c e p t o n the a s s u m p t i o n th a t a s u c c e s s i v e and l i m i t e d c o m p a r i s o n of p o l i t i c a l a l t e r n a t i v e s a p p e a r s to be m o r e r a t i o n a l a n d m a n a g e ­ a b l e t h a n c o m p r e h e n s i v e a n a l y s i s a n d n e w f o r m u l a t i o n of p o l i c y p r o g r a m m e s . A c c o r d i n g to L i n d b l o m , " m u d d l i n g t h r o u g h " is

n o t o n l y an a p p r o p r i a t e d e s c r i p t i o n of w h a t f r e q u e n t l y h a p p e n s in a p l u r a l i s t i c society, b u t a l s o of w h a t "should" tak e p l a c e

( E n g e l h a r d t 1970, P r e m f o r s 1981).

(4)

T h e c o n c e p t u a l a s p e c t s of i n c r e m e n t a l i s m w e r e d e v e l o p e d f u r t h e r by W i l d a v s k y a n d a p p l i e d to the b u d g e t a r y p r o c e s s

( W i l d a v s k y 1964, 1965). In t h i s conte x t , i n c r e m e n t a l i s m s t a t e s t h a t c h a n g e s in i n d i v i d u a l p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e p r o g r a m m e s

a r e o n l y of i n c r e m e n t a l o r m a r g i n a l n ature, and, h e n c e , t h e b u d g e t a r y p r o c e s s in a n y f i s c a l y e a r is b e s t u n d e r s t o o d as l a r g e l y a r e v i s i o n of p r e v i o u s b u d g e t s . Thi s m e a n s t h a t the s i z e a n d s h a r e of a n i n d i v i d u a l p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e in the p r e ­ s e n t b u d g e t is p r e d o m i n a n t l y i n f l u e n c e d b y its s i z e a n d s h a r e in t h e p r e v i o u s bu d g e t . T h e o u t c o m e , h o w e v e r , r e f l e c t s a c o m ­ p l e x p o l i t i c a l b e h a v i o r a l p a t t e r n a n d s t r a t e g y of the agents in v o l v e d in the b u d g e t a r y p r o c e s s . T h e i n t e r p l a y of t h e s e f o r c e s r e s u l t s in the r e l a t i v e s t a b i l i t y of the b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e

( D a v i s / D e m p s t e r / W i l d a v s k y 1966). D e s p i t e the a p p a r e n t s h o r t ­ c o m i n g s of the i n c r e m e n t a l a p p r o a c h ( B a i l e y / 0 'C o n n o r 1975; Le- l o u p 1978a), it n e v e r t h e l e s s r e m a i n e d the a c c e p t e d b u d g e t a r y ap p r o a c h . T h i s is a l i t t l e s u r p r i s i n g , s i nce it o n l y e x p l a i n s the s h o r t - r u n s t a b i l i t y of t h e b u d g e t a n d its s t r u c t u r e a n d p r o ­ v i d e s no e x p l a n a t i o n of n o n - i n c r e m e n t a l s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s a n d s h i f t s a m o n g t h e v a r i o u s e x p e n d i t u r e c o m p o n e n t s . In p a r t i c u l a r , t h e l a t t e r a s p e c t s c o u l d h a v e b e e n r e l a t i v e l y e a s i l y a c c o m m o ­ d a t e d b y t h e p r o p o n e n t s o f i n c r e m e n t a l i s m b y r e a l i z i n g t h a t a n n u a l i n c r e m e n t a l c h a n g e s in v a r i o u s p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e c o m p o ­ n e n t s r e s u l t in n o t i c e a b l e b u d g e t a r y s h i f t s o v e r t i m e (Rose/

P a g e 1981). D e s p i t e t h e s e r e s e r v a t i o n s , i n c r e m e n t a l i s m c a n b e u s e d as a r e f e r e n c e t h e o r y for e x p l a i n i n g b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s o v e r time. W h a t is n e e d e d is an a p p r o a c h a d e q u a t e for e x p l a i n i n g m i d - t e r m c h a n g e s of t h e b u d g e t a r y e x p e n d i t u r e p a t ­ tern, a n d thus, to e s t a b l i s h a l i n k b e t w e e n the s t a t e m e n t of

t h e l o n g r u n t r e n d of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e g r o w t h a n d the s h o r t r u n s t a b i l i t y o f t h e e x p e n d i t u r e p a t t e r n .

In this c o n t e x t , the q u e s t i o n i m m e d i a t e l y a r i s e s as to w h a t e x t e n t t h e e c o n o m i c t h e o r y of d e m o c r a c y (Downs 1957) or the

"Ne w P o l i t i c a l E c o n o m y " (Frey 1978) can p r o v i d e s u c h a m i d ­ t e r m a p p r o a c h , w h i c h c o u l d e x p l a i n the b u d g e t a r y b e h a v i o r d u r i n g a g i v e n l e g i s l a t i v e p e r i o d . A t a c o n c e p t u a l level, it is c o n c e i v a b l e t h a t t h e p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s o f f e r e d b y the p o l i t i c a l p a r t i e s as a c t o r s a r e r a n k e d a c c o r d i n g to t h e i r d i ­ m i n i s h i n g m a r g i n a l v o t e g a i n s a n d a r e f i n a n c e d r e s p e c t i v e l y a c ­ c o r d i n g to t h e i r m a r g i n a l i n c r e a s i n g v o t e losses, i.e., the e x p e n d i t u r e s a r e f i n a n c e d b y les s a n d less p o p u l a r taxes. T h e r e s u l t i n g b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e is v i e w e d b y t h e r e s p e c t i v e p o l i t i c a l p a r t y as o p t i m a l in its s e a r c h for g a i n i n g the p o l i t i c a l m a j o r i t y . S i n c e t h e e m p i r i c a l t e s t i n g of t h e s e m o d e l s is r a t h e r d i f f i c u l t , o n l y c a u t i o u s a t t e m p t s w e r e m a d e to a p p l y t h e m in r e a l i t y (cp. S c h ü r g e r s 1980). F o r e x a m p l e , t h e a n a l y s i s of p o ­ l i t i c a l " b u s i n e s s c y c l e s " r e s t r i c t s i t s e l f to an e x p l a n a t i o n of

p o l i t i c a l l y g e n e r a t e d f l u c t u a t i o n s of e c o n o m i c a c t i v i t y a n d of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s a n d r e v e n u e s , b u t it is h a r d l y f o c u s s i n g on, b u d g e t size a n d its s t r u c t u r e . In v i e w of t h e e x i s t i n g l e ­ v e l of i n f o r m a t i o n a n d of the a b s o r p t i o n c a p a c i t y o f v o t e r s a n d p o l i t i c i a n s , t h e c o n f i d e n c e in the a l l o c a t i o n m e c h a n i s m

" e l e c t i o n p r o c e s s " as a r e f l e c t i o n of the m e d i a n

v o t e r ' s p r e f e r e n c e a p p e a r s to be r a t h e r h e r o i c . T h e t r a n s m i s ­ s i o n of d e s i r a b l e i m a g e s o f p o l i t i c i a n s a n d of p o l i t i c a l s l o ­ g a n s a s s o c i a t e d w i t h " s t a b i l i t y " , " c o n f i d e n c e " , " d e c i s i v e n e s s "

a n d " s t r e n g t h " m a y l e a d to an e l e c t i o n v i c t o r y , b u t the s u p p l y

(6)

of p u b l i c g o o d s and, t h e r e f o r e , the b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e is u n ­ l i k e l y to b e d i r e c t l y i n f l u e n c e d a n d c o n t r o l l e d b y the v o t e r s

( M a c k s c h e i d t 1973, p. 286). C o n s e q u e n t l y , t h e e x p l a n a t o r y v a ­ lue o f t h e v o t e - m a x i m i z i n g h y p o t h e s i s a n d the e c o n o m i c t h e o r y of d e m o c r a c y c o n c e r n i n g t h e b u d g e t s t r u c t u r e a n d its d e v e l o p ­ m e n t is r e l a t i v e l y l i m i t e d t o s t r e s s i n g t h e i m p o r t a n c e of p o l i ­ t i c a l p r o c e s s e s for a p o s i t i v e a l l o c a t i o n t h e o r y of p u b l i c

e x p e n d i t u r e s . Thus, it w o u l d a l r e a d y be a n i m p r o v e m e n t in t h e d e v e l o p m e n t of a c o m p l e x a n d c o h e r e n t t h e o r y of b u d g e t a r y s truc t u r e s a n d its c h a n g e s if i n i t i a l l y a p p r o p r i a t e v a r i a b l e s c o u l d b e i d e n t i f i e d , w h i c h c o u l d e x p l a i n in the s h o r t , i n t e r m e d i a t e a n d l o n g runs, t h e s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s in p u b l i c budg e t s , w i t h r e s p e c t to the v a r i o u s g o v e r n m e n t a l levels. P o t e n t i a l c a n d i ­ d a t e s for s u c h a t h e o r y c o u l d b e s o c i o - e c o n o m i c , p o l i t i c a l a n d i n s t i t u t i o n a l v a r i a b l e s ( D y e / R o b e y 1980) w h i c h w i l l be a n a l y z e d b e l o w in d e t a i l a n d u t i l i z e d as e l e m e n t s o f a n e m p i r i c a l l y

t e s t a b l e theory.

I I . D e t e r m i n a n t s o f B u d g e t a r y S t r u c t u r e a n d Its C h a n g e s

L i t t l e e x p e r t i s e is r e q u i r e d to r e c o g n i z e t h a t p u b l i c e x ­ p e n d i t u r e s h a v e b e e n i n c r e a s i n g o v e r time. T h i s t r e n d is s t i l l a p o p u l a r s u b j e c t of d i s c u s s i o n a m o n g e c o n o m i s t s a n d p o l i t i c a l s c i e n t i s t s . S e v e r a l m o d e l s a n d n u m e r o u s f a c t o r s w e r e h y p o t h e ­ s i z e d as e x p l a n a t o r y d e t e r m i n a n t s of b u d g e t size, s t r u c t u r e a n d of its c h a n g e s o v e r t i m e .

1. T h e S o c i o - E c o n o m i c V a r i a b l e s

In p a r t i c u l a r , T h o m a s R. D y e (1966) s t r e s s e s s o c i o - e c o n o m i c f a c t o r s as d e t e r m i n a n t s o f p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s . His o b j e c t i v e

(7)

is to i l l u s t r a t e the g o v e r n m e n t ' s d e p e n d e n c e o n e c o n o m i c f a c t o r s in t h e s o c i e t y a n d to s h o w t h a t the g o v e r n m e n t p o s ­ s e s s e s l i t t l e or n o a u t o n o m y in its a c t i v i t i e s . It is not i n ­ t e n d e d h e r e t o v e r i f y of f a l s i f y t h i s h y p o t h e s i s , b u t r a t h e r to e x t r a c t f r o m t h i s a p p r o a c h some f a c t o r s w h i c h c a n be u s e d for t h e d e v e l o p m e n t of a t e s t a b l e t h e o r y of b u d g e t s t r u c t u r e s a n d its c h a n g e s .

(1) T h e n a t i o n a l i n c o m e a n d its g r o w t h r a t e r e p r e s e n t i m ­ p o r t a n t d e t e r m i n a n t s o f p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s . Thi s re- 2 lates to W a g n e r ' s l a w of e x p a n d i n g s t a t e a c t i v i t i e s . (2) S o m e e m p i r i c a l s t u d i e s h a v e s u g g e s t e d t h a t a h i g h d e ­

g r e e of i n t e r n a t i o n a l t r a d e d e p e n d e n c e m a y c o n t r i b u t e to the g r o w t h o f p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s (Cam e r o n 1978). F o l ­ l o w i n g t h e fac t t h a t the g o v e r n m e n t c a n n o t p u r s u e n e o ­

m e r c a n t i l i s t s t r a t e g i e s e s p e c i a l l y in s m a l l o p e n e c o ­ n o m i e s , it h a s to t a k e o v e r s o m e r e s p o n s i b i l i t y to m a i n ­ t a i n a n d / o r i m p r o v e t h e c o u n t r y ' s i n t e r n a t i o n a l c o m p e - t i v e n e s s and, t h e r e f o r e , is r e q u i r e d t o d e s i g n a n d i m ­ p l e m e n t e x p e n d i t u r e p r o g r a m m e s for i n c o m e m a i n t e n a n c e a n d s u p p o r t w h i c h m a y i n c l u d e e x p e n d i t u r e s for s o c i a l s e c u r i t y , e d u c a t i o n a n d r e s e a r c h , s u b s i d i z a t i o n of job- c r e a t i n g p r o g r a m m e s , etc.

(3) T h e u n e m p l o y m e n t r a t e is a t h i r d f a c t o r i n f l u e n c i n g the s i z e a n d c o m p o s i t i o n of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s (Davis/

D e m p s t e r / W i l d a v s k y 1974). S i n c e the a c h i e v e m e n t of full e m p l o y m e n t r a n k s h i g h in the g o v e r n m e n t ' s p r i o r i t y list, v a r i o u s e m p l o y m e n t c r e a t i n g e x p e n d i t u r e p r o g r a m m e s are r e f l e c t e d in t h e p u b l i c budget.

(4) T h e m a n o e v r a b i l i t y for an e x p a n s i o n 'of p u b l i c ex-

(8)

p e n d i t u r e a c t i v i t i e s is a l s o d e t e r m i n e d b y the p r o d u c ­ t i o n s t r u c t u r e a n d c a p a c i t y o f t h e e c o n o m y , i.e., by the e l a s t i c i t y of the p r o d u c t i o n s e c t o r . C o n s e q u e n t l y , g o v e r n m e n t p r o g r a m m e s c a n n o t b e i m p l e m e n t e d if the e c o ­ n o m y ' s p r o d u c t i o n s t r u c t u r e c o n t a i n s b o t t l e n e c k s a n d is i n f l e x i b l e to a c c o m m o d a t e p u b l i c d e m a n d s (Leloup 1978b).

(5) F i n a l l y , the age c o m p o s i t i o n of t h e p o p u l a t i o n al s o c a n b e c o n s i d e r e d as a d e t e r m i n a n t for s p e c i f i c p u b l i c e x ­ p e n d i t u r e s p r o g r a m m e s . A b a b y - b o o m f o l l o w i n g the end of a w a r m a y r e q u i r e v e r y s p e c i f i c g o v e r n m e n t a l e x p e n d i t u r e s . F o r e x a m p l e , as thi s b a b y - b o o m c o h o r t m o v e s through the popu­

l a t i o n p y r a m i d , s p e c i f i c p u b l i c d e m a n d s h a v e to b e s a ­ t i s f i e d , s u c h as h i g h e r p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s for e d u c a ­ tion, s p o r t s , s o c i a l s e c u r i t y , etc. ( H o l c o m b e / Z a r d k o o h i 1 9 8 0 /81).

2. P o l i t i c a l V a r i a b l e s

B e s i d e s t h e s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s , p o l i t i c a l f a c t o r s m a y a l s o b e s i g n i f i c a n t in i n f l u e n c i n g the s t r u c t u r e of p u b ­

lic e x p e n d i t u r e s .

(1) E x p e n d i t u r e s a r e to be e v a l u a t e d n o t o n l y a c c o r d i n g to t h e i r e c o n o m i c impa c t s , b u t a l s o w i t h r e s p e c t to t h e i r p o l i t i c a l i m p a c t s i.e., a c c o r d i n g to t h e i r c h a r a c t e r i s ­ t i c s o f u s e f u l n e s s for t h e r e c i p i e n t s . T h e v a r i a b l e suggests

that individual expenditures will increase if the political benefits are m o r e v i s i b l e t h a n t h e costs, i.e., t h e taxes, and, thus .the competincf p a r t i e s a r e e x p e c t i n q to' g a i n a n d / o r

to m a i n t a i n t h e i r s u p p o r t w i t h i n the e l e c t o r a t e (Klein 1976) Thus, t h e c o n c e p t of p o l i t i c a l v i s i b i l i t y , i n c l u d i n g its fea t u r e s o f c e r t a i n t y a n d g e n e r a l i t y , is useful in explaining the

(9)

type, as w e l l as the l e v e l a n d s t r u c t u r e , of p u b l i c e x ­ p e n d i t u r e s o n v a r i o u s p r o g r a m m e s .

(2) A n a d d i t i o n a l v a r i a b l e among t h e p o l i t i c a l d e t e r m i n a n t s is the d e g r e e of c o n t r o l l a b i l i t y of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s . M a n y d e c i s i o n - m a k e r s r e f e r to the fac t t h a t a l a r g e a n d p o t e n t i a l l y g r o w i n g p o r t i o n of the p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s is c o n s i d e r e d as " u n c o n t r o l l a b l e s ", i.e., this p o r t i o n is b e y o n d t h e a n n u a l d i s c r e t i o n of the d e c i s i o n m a k e r s . D e s p i t e s o m e v a g u e n e s s in t h e c o n t r o l l a b l e / u n c o n t r o l l a b l e d i c h o t o m y , s o m e p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s c a n be i d e n t i f i e d w i t h c e r t a i n t y as u n c o n t r o l l a b l e c o m p o n e n t s . T h i s c a t e ­ g o r y i n c l u d e s f i x e d c o s t s (e.g., i n t e r e s t p a y m e n t s on

p u b l i c d e b t s ) , m u l t i - y e a r c o n t r a c t s a n d o b l i g a t i o n s (e.g. , l a r g e - s c a l e g o v e r n m e n t p r o j e c t s ) , a n d v a r i o u s e n t i t l e m e n t p r o g r a m m e s (e.g., s o c i a l s e c u r i t y , m e d i c a r e , p e n s i o n p a y m e n t s , etc.).

(3) P r o b a b l y , t h e m o s t i m p o r t a n t f a c t o r w i t h i n the s e t of p o l i t i c a l d e t e r m i n a n t s is t h e p o l i t i c a l p r e f e r e n c e . A c ­ c o r d i n g t o e m p i r i c a l s t u d i e s a n d c o n t r a r y to h y p o t h e s i s of t h e " d e c l i n e of i d e o l o g y " (Lipset 1960), p o l i t i c a l

p r e f e r e n c e s a r e i m p o r t a n t in i n f l u e n c i n g the d e v e l o p m e n t a n d the c o m p o s i t i o n of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s . T h e p o l i t i c a l p o s i t i o n o f a g o v e r n m e n t is a s s o c i a t e d w i t h the r a t e of e x p a n s i o n a n d ty p e of programmes. W h e t h e r a c o u n t r y 's g o v e r n ­ m e n t is g e n e r a l l y d o m i n a t e d b y a l e f t i s t or b y a c o n s e r v a -

;t i v e p a r t y p r o v i d e s an i m p o r t a n t h i n t to the r e l a t i v e d e ­ c r e e of c h a n g e in t h e siz e and s t r u c t u r e of t h e p u b l i c b u d g e t (Schmidt 1 982).

(4) R e l a t e d to the political preferences (government, parties, voters)

(10)

•is the f a c t o r of i n t e r e s t g r o u p s o r g a n i z a t i o n a n d its i n f l u e n c e o n the g o v e r n m e n t : s o c i a l i s t a n d / o r s o c i a l d e ­ m o c r a t i c p a r t i e s p r e d o m i n a n t l y r e c e i v e t h e i r s u p p o r t f r o m the w o r k i n g c l a s s a n d t r a d e u n i o n s , w h i l e l i b e r a l a n d / o r c o n s e r v a t i v e p a r t i e s r e l y r e l a t i v e l y s t r o n g e r o n the s u p ­ p o r t f r o m b o u r g e o i s p a r t s of t h e v o t e r s . V a r i o u s i n t e r e s t gr o u p s , e.g., e m p l o y e r s ' a s s o c i a t i o n s a n d t r a d e - u n i o n s , m a y e x e r c i s e d i f f e r e n t d e g r e e s of p r e s s u r e on g o v e r n m e n t ' s p r o g r a m m e s . T h e s t r e n g t h of t h e s e g r o u p s m a y b e o p e r a t i o n s l i z e d as a f u n c t i o n of v a r i o u s v a r i a b l e s w h i c h m a y i n c l u d e f a c t o r s s u c h as n u m b e r of m e m b e r s , f i n a n c i a l p o t e n t i a l , p r e s t i g e , b u t a l s o t h e p o s s i b i l i t y of t h r e a t a n d d i s t u r b ­ a n c e i.e., to q u e s t i o n a n d / o r t h r e a t e n the r e a l i z a t i o n a n d i m p l e m e n t a t i o n o f . p o l i t i c a l p r e f e r e n c e s of o t h e r g r o u p s

(Fürst 1975).

3. I n s t i t u t i o n a l - A d m i n i s t r a t i v e V a r i a b l e s

A t h i r d s e t of v a r i a b l e s for t h e e x p l a n a t i o n of the e x p a n ­ s i o n of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s i n v o l v e s the i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i ­ n i s t r a t i v e s t r u c t u r e o f g o v e r n m e n t s .

(1) T h e s e n i o r i t y /size of a p a r t i c u l a r expenditure programme is an i n d i c a t o r for c o n f i r m i n g t h e i m p o r t a n c e of i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i n i s t r a t i v e factors. It s u g g e s t s t h a t t h e r e is a b u i l t - in r e s i s t a n c e f r o m w i t h i n t h e g o v e r n m e n t a l i n s t i t u t i o n s to c h a n g e s in the e x i s t i n g b u d g e t a r y r e s o u r c e a l l o c a t i o n . F r e ­ q u e n t l y t h e s e e x p e n d i t u r e p r o g r a m m e s are m a n p o w e r - i n t e n ­ s i v e a n d / o r h i g h l y b u r e a u c r a t i z e d . In an i n t e r m e d i a t e a n d l o n g - r u n a n a l y s i s , h o w e v e r , it is to be e x p e c t e d t h a t o l d

(11)

a n d e s t a b l i s h e d p r o g r a m m e s w i l l a p p e a r as s t r u c t u r a l l y s t a g n a t i n g , if t h e y d o n o t s u c c e e d in a r t i c u l a t i n g a n d f o r m u l a t i n g n e w n e e d s a n d p r o g r a m m e s (Klein 1976, p. 427).

(2) W i t h r e s p e c t to the f a c t o r of a d m i n i s t r a t i v e f l e x i b i l i t y , it c a n b e a s s u m e d t h a t t r a n s f e r p a y m e n t p r o g r a m m e s - p r o ­ v i d e d t h e l e gal b a s i s is g i v e n - can be e a s i e r a n d f a ­ s t e r i m p l e m e n t e d t h a n p r o g r a m m e s t h a t r e q u i r e p u r c h a s e s of g o o d s a n d s e r v i c e s , p u b l i c tender, etc. In p a r t i c u l a r , i n v e s t m e n t p r o j e c t s h a v e to be a p p r o v e d and, t h e r e f o r e , h a v e l o n g e r t e c h n i c a l - a d m i n i s t r a t i v e p l a n n i n g a n d i m ­ p l e m e n t a t i o n lags. C o n s e q u e n t l y , d u e to t h e d i f f e r i n g lag s of i n v e s t m e n t e x p e n d i t u r e s in c o m p a r i s o n to t r a n s ­ f e r e x p e n d i t u r e s , a d i s c o n t i n u o u s p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e p a t t e r n emerg e s .

(3) A n a d d i t i o n a l a s p e c t of the i n s t i t u t i o n a l ~ a d m i n i s t r a t i v e v a r i a b l e s e t is t h e d e g r e e of f i s c a l c e n t r a l i z a t i o n . T h e v a r i a b l e of f i s c a l c e n t r a l i z a t i o n , d e f i n e d h e r e as the p e r c e n t a g e of a l l g o v e r n m e n t s ' r e v e n u e s s p e n t b y the c e n ­ t r a l g o v e r n m e n t , r e p r e s e n t s the f o r m a l i n s t i t u t i o n a l a d ­ m i n i s t r a t i v e s t r u c t u r e of t h e g o v e r n m e n t . A c c o r d i n g to t h e e c o n o m i c t h e o r y of p o l i t i c s , it m a y b e p r e d i c t e d , t h a t t h e r e is an i n h e r e n t t e n d e n c y for e x p a n s i o n of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s , the g r e a t e r t h e n u m b e r of s p e n d i n g a u t h o r i t i e s and q u a s i - a u t o n o m o u s l e v e l s o f g o v e r n m e n t is a n d the h i g h e r the s h a r e of e x p e n d i t u r e s a t a p a r t i c u l a r f e d e r a l l e v e l is w h i c h is n o t b e i n g f i n a n c e d f r o m r e v e ­ n u e s g e n e r a t e d at t h i s g o v e r n m e n t a l level, i.e., w h e r e f i s c a l e q u i v a l e n c e d o e s n o t p r e v a i l (Tarschys 1975).

(12)

D u e to t h e l a c k of a c o h e r e n t p o s i t i v e t h e o r y of the d e v e l o p ­ m e n t a n d s t r u c t u r e of p u b l i c e x p e n d i t u r e s , t h e a b o v e - m e n t i o n e d s e t of v a r i a b l e s c o u l d b e c o n s i d e r e d as an i n i t i a l step in the d i r e c t i o n of d e v e l o p i n g s u c h a t heory. T h e i n f l u e n c e and i m ­ p o r t a n c e of e a c h v a r i a b l e o n t h e d e v e l o p m e n t of t h e b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e w i l l v a r y and, f u r t h e r m o r e , it m a y b e c o n c e p t u a l l y q u i t e d i f f i c u l t to i s o l a t e e a c h v a r i a b l e ' s i n f l u e n c e on t h e p u b l i c b u d g e t d u e to t h e h i g h d e g r e e of i n t e r d e p e n d e n c e .

T h e t i m e f a c t o r m a y a l s o b e d e c i s i v e in an e x t e n d e d a n a l y ­ sis. T h e c o n t r i b u t i o n of e a c h v a r i a b l e set to t h e e x p l a n a t i o n of s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s of the p u b l i c b u d g e t w i l l p r o b a b l y

v a r y w i t h the l e n g t h of t h e t i m e p e r i o d c hosen. In th i s c o n ­ text, it c o u l d be h y p o t h e s i z e d t h a t the s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i ­ a b l e s m a y h a v e a m o r e s u b s t a n t i a l i n f l u e n c e in t h e l o n g - r u n d e t e r m i n a t i o n of s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s , w h i l e the p o l i t i c a l a n d i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i n i s t r a t i v e v a r i a b l e s m a y p r i m a r i l y i n f l u e n c e

i n t e r m e d i a t e a n d s h ö r t - r u n v a r i a t i o n s .

III. E m p i r i c a l A n a l y s i s of t h e D e t e r m i n a n t s o f B u d g e t a r y S t r u c t u r a l C h a n g e s for t h e P e r i o d , 1 9 6 4 - 1 9 7 8

1 . D a t a B a s e a n d M e t h o d o l o g i c a l P r o c e d u r e s

T h e e m p i r i c a l a n a l y s i s is b a s e d o n a d a t a s e t w h i c h w a s s p e c i a l l y c o m p i l e d f o r t h i s a n a l y s i s of s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s in t h e p u b l i c b u d g e t s o f t h e F e d e r a l R e p u b l i c of G e r m a n y

( i n clusive o f t h e a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l level, federal, lan d a n d m u n i c i p a l level) ( Z i m m e r m a n n / M ü l l e r 1985).

In s e c t i o n I of t h i s a r t i c l e , it w a s m e n t i o n e d t h a t t h e r e is n o t an a c c e p t e d c o h e r e n t p o s i t i v e t h e o r y o f c h a n g e s in the

b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e . E v e n so, the i n c r e m e n t a l a p p r o a c h p r o ­ v i d e s an e x p l a n a t i o n o f t h e r e l a t i v e c o n s t a n c y of t h e b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e . T h e c o n c e p t of " s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s " directly relates to it : It m e a s u r e s t h e d e v i a t i o n of an e x p e c t e d s i z e of a p a r ­

t i c u l a r e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r y , b a s e d on its p r e v i o u s y e a r ' s s h a r e - a s s u m i n g a c o n s t a n t b u d g e t a r y s t r u c t u r e - f r o m the a c ­ t u a l v a l u e o f thi s e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r y in a p a r t i c u l a r y e a r

( D a n ziger 1976). T h i s c o n c e p t w i l l b e u s e d e x c l u s i v e l y w i t h i n t h e e m p i r i c a l a n a l y s i s . T h e s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s e e m s to b e the a p p r o p r i a t e m e a s u r e of " w h e r e t h e a c t i o n is" (Rose/Page, p.7), b e c a u s e t h e d i f f e r e n c e b e t w e e n the a c t u a l l e v e l of a p a r t i c u l a r e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r y a n d its e x p e c t e d level, a s ­ s u m i n g c o n s t a n c y o f t h e b u d g e t s t r u c t u r e , r e p r e s e n t s an indicator

(14)

of a d y n a m i c p r o c e s s of s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e o v e r time, w h i c h c a n be e x p l a i n e d b y t h e set s of e c o n o m i c , p o l i t i c a l a n d / o r i n ­ s t i t u t i o n a l f a c t o r s . In c o n t r a s t to a s i m p l e c o m p a r i s o n of s h i f t i n g s h a r e s o v e r time, t h i s c o n c e p t h a s t h e a d v a n t a g e , a s s u m i n g t h a t the n o m i n a l e x p e n d i t u r e s are c o r r e c t l y d e f l a t e d ,

to p r o v i d e a d a t a b a s e w h i c h is s u i t a b l e for s u m m a r i z i n g and p r e s e n t i n g m e a s u r e s f o r s e l e c t e d t i m e p e r i o d s . P r o c e e d i n g in t h a t m a n n e r , e x c h a n g e p r o c e s s e s b e t w e e n d i f f e r e n t e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s as w e l l as r e c o v e r y o f e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s to t h e i r i n i t i a l p o s i t i o n o v e r t i m e c a n b e a n a l y z e d , w h e r e b y the r e ­ s u l t s w i l l n o t b e d o m i n a t e d b y t h e d a t a o f the m o r e r e c e n t t i m e p e r i o d s .

The d a t a of t h e s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s as a q u a n t i t a t i v e e x p r e s s i o n for s t r u c t u r a l c h a n g e s in p u b l i c b u d g e t s o v e r f i f t e e n y e a r s a n d for t h i r t e e n e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r i e s w e r e f u r t h e r a n a l y z e d u s i n g m u l t i p l e c o r r e l a t i o n a n a l y s i s . F o r th i s p u r p o s e the a b o v e d i s c u s s e d 12 v a r i a b l e s w e r e d e s c r i b e d by 35 i n d i c a t o r s .

F o r 2 v a r i a b l e s (p o l i t i c a l v i s i b i l i t y , d e ­

g r e e of c o n t r o l l a b i l i t y f r o m the s e t of t h e p o l i t i c a l v a r i a b l e s ) it w a s n o t p o s s i b l e to c o m p u t e i n d i c a t o r s b a s e d o n a n n u a l data, so t h a t in t h e s e c a s e s t h e r e l a t i v e r a n k i n g of p a r t i c u l a r e x ­ p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s a c c o r d i n g to s e l e c t e d i n d i c a t o r s w e r e a u x i - l i a r i l y c o r r e l a t e d w i t h the a c c u m u l a t e d s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s o f e a c h e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p a n d t h e i r i n d i v i d u a l r a n k i n g s (for d e t a i l s see: Z i m m e r m a n n / M ü l l e r 1985, pp. 217). Th i s e v a l u a ­ t i o n is, h o w e v e r , less r e l e v a n t a n d s i g n i f i c a n t t h a n t h e a n a ­ l y s i s b a s e d o n a n n u a l data, a n d t h u s t h e r e s u l t s g e n e r a t e d on t h i s l e v e l of a n a l y s i s a r e o n l y u s e d a d d i t i o n a l l y in sup-

(15)

p o r t of the m a i n a n a l y s i s . F r o m t h e a b o v e v a r i a b l e sets, t h e m a i n a n a l y s i s is t h e r e f o r e b a s e d on 10 v a r i a b l e s w h i c h a r e r e ­ p r e s e n t e d b y 31 i n d i c a t o r s . T h e s e 10 v a r i a b l e s c o m p r i s e m a i n ­ ly t h e s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s w h i c h n u m b e r 5, (national i n ­ come, i n t e r n a t i o n a l o p e n e s s , u n e m p l o y m e n t rate, e l a s t i c i t y of the p r o d u c t i o n se c t o r , a n d the age c o m p o s i t i o n o f the p o p u l a ­ tion) , 3 v a r i a b l e s of t h e i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i n i s t r a t i v e set (size

of e x p e n d i t u r e , a d m i n i s t r a t i v e f l e x i b i l i t y , f i s c a l c e n t r a l i z a ­ tion) a n d o n l y 2 v a r i a b l e s o f the p o l i t i c a l v a r i a b l e set ( p oli­

t i c a l p r e f e r e n c e s , i n t e r e s t groups) d u e to the p r o b l e m of a d - 4

e q u a t e q u a n t i f i c a t i o n .

T h e f u r t h e r a n a l y s i s f o l l o w s in its m e t h o d o l o g i c a l and c o n ­ c e p t u a l p r o c e d u r e t h e " p o l i c y - o u t c o m e " - a p p r o a c h , w h i c h w a s d e ­ v e l o p e d b y T.R. D y e (1966). T h e e m p i r i c a l a n a l y s i s e m p l o y s a

t w o - s t e p m e t h o d of m u l t i p l e c o r r e l a t i o n a n a l y s i s :

(1) I n i t i a l l y , the d e t e r m i n a n t s , r e s p e c t i v e l y i n d i c a t o r s , of the t h r e e v a r i a b l e s sets a n d the s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s of e a c h e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r y are r e l a t e d to e a c h o t h e r e m ­ p l o y i n g s t e p w i s e m u l t i p l e c o r r e l a t i o n a n a l y s i s ; (Table I.

C o l u m n s (1) - (3)).

(2) R e s p e c t i v e l y , t h e f i r s t two i n d i c a t o r s of the t h ree g r o u p s of s o c i o - e c o n o m i c , p o l i t i c a l a n d i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i n i s t r a ­ t i v e v a r i a b l e s , w h i c h e m e r g e f r o m thi s p r o c e d u r e , are

a g a i n c o r r e l a t e d w i t h the s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s . The r e s u l t s r e p r e s e n t m u l t i p l e c o r r e l a t i o n c o e f f i c i e n t s for the w h o l e v a r i a b l e s e t (see T a b l e I C o l u m n 4).

(16)

A l t h o u g h t h e a n a l y s i s t a k e s i n t o a c c o u n t t h e f o u r g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l s - t h e a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l ( F L M ) , f e d e r a l ( F ) , L a n d ( L ) , a n d m u n i c i p a l i t i e s (M) - , an e v a l u a t i o n of the r e ­ s u l t s f o r e a c h s p e c i f i c l e v e l is l a r g e l y o m i t t e d . Instead,

a c c o r d i n g t o t h e g o a l of the s t u d y t o e x p l a i n s u b s t i t u t i o n o r o c e s s e s f o r e x p e n d i t u r e gro u p s , a c o m p a r a t i v e e v a l u a t i o n ■ of the various- g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l s f o r the d i f f e r e n t e x p e n d i ­ t u r e g r o u p s w i l l be p r o v i d e d . In p r i n c i p l e , the sets o f i n d i ­ c a t o r s are b a s e d on l e v e l - s p e c i f i c data, a n d o n l y in the c a s e of the a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l (FLM) i.e., d u e to the a g g r e g a t i o n , i n d i c a t o r s of d i f f e r e n t l e v e l s w i l l be e m p l o y e d t°o, m a i n l y f r o m the i n s t i t u t i o n a l - a d m i n i s t r a t i v e v a r i a b l e set.

F r o m the a b o v e r e s u l t s , no c l e a r t o t a l p i c t u r e e m e r g e s a n d t h e l e v e l - s p e c i f i c d i f f e r e n c e s a r e n o t c l e a r - c u t . N e v e r ­ t h e l e s s , the g e n e r a l d o m i n a n c e of t h e i n s t i t u t i o n a l v a r i a b l e s e t c a n be c o n f i r m e d , h o w e v e r , it is less c l e a r l y p r o n o u n c e d at t h e m u n i c i p a l level. T h e s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e set is to a l e s s e r d e g r e e d o m i n a n t . It is m o r e e f f e c t i v e at the f e d e r a l a n d to a l e s s e r d e g r e e at the a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l and Laender levels, a n d r e l a t i v e l y w e a k at the m u n i c i p a l level. S u b s t a n ­ t i a l d i f f e r e n c e s a r i s e o n l y in the l e v e l - s p e c i f i c i m p o r t a n c e of the p o l i t i c a l v a r i a b l e set: E v e n if o n e c o n c e d e s tha t the p o l i t i c a l v a r i a b l e set is of l e s s e r i m p o r t a n c e , n e v e r t h e l e s s t h e s e f a c t o r s a r e o b s e r v a b l e in p a r t i c u l a r at the m u n i c i p a l level, a n d w e a k e r at t h e s u c c e s s i v e l y h i g h e r g o v e r n m e n t a l l e ­ vels. A c c o r d i n g to o u r a n a l y s i s , it s e e m s t h a t the m u n i c i p a l l e v e l - if a n y - m a y b e c o n s i d e r e d as the l e v e l at w h i c h p o l i ­ t i c a l v a r i a b l e s a r e m o r e p r o n o u n c e d , w h i l e e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s b e c o m e m o r e a p p a r e n t at the f e d e r a l level. T h e l a t e r o b s e r v a ­ tion, h o w e v e r , is n o t s u r p r i s i n g s i n c e t h e f e d e r a l g o v e r n m e n t is m a i n l y r e s p o n s i b l e for m a c r o - e c o n o m i c s t a b i l i z a t i o n p o l i ­ c i e s .

T h e a b o v e r e s u l t s a r e i l l u m i n a t e d m o r e in de t a i l , if in a d d i t i o n the e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s a n d t h e i r r e s p e c t i v e l o n g - r u n t r e n d s o f t h e s u b s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s (i.e. a c c u m u l a t e d s u b ­ s t i t u t i o n e f f e c t s for the p e r i o d 1 9 6 4-1978) a r e c o m p a r e d w i t h t h e r e s u l t s o f t h e c o r r e l a t i o n a n a l y s i s (data a n d c a l c u l a t i o n s n o t r e c o r d e d h e r e ) .

(24)

O n t h e a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l a n d f e d e r a l levels, t h e s o ­ c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s a r e m a i n l y r e s p o n s i b l e for s u b s t i t u t i o n gains, w h e r e a s t h e p o l i t i c a l a n d a l s o the i n s t i t u t i o n a l v a r i ­ a b l e s e x p l a i n to a l a r g e e x t e n t the s u b s t i t u t i o n losses. T h e c o n t r a r y t a k e s p l a c e o n t h e Laender level, h e r e the i n s t i t u t i o ­ n a l v a r i a b l e s h a v e t h e s t r o n g e s t i n f l u e n c e o n the e x p e n d i t u r e s gro u p s , w h i c h g a i n e d d u r i n g t h e s u b s t i t u t i o n p r o c e s s , w h i l e the s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s w e r e d o m i n a n t f o r the e x p e n d i t u r e s g roups, w h i c h h a v e l o s t s h a r e s d u r i n g the s u b s t i t u t i o n p r o c e s s . A t the m u n i c i p a l level, t h e s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s p l a y a d e ­ c i s i v e r o l e in e x p l a i n i n g s u b s t i t u t i o n gains, b u t als o s u b s t i -

s t u t i o n losses.. In sum, the

c o n c l u s i o n s of D a v i s / D e m p s t e r / W i l d a v s k y (1974, p. 451) c a n n o t be c o n f i r m e d for t h e G e r m a n s i t u a t i o n i.e., t h a t the s o c i o - e c o ­ n o m i c f a c t o r s in c o n t r a s t to p o l i t i c a l f a c t o r s are e x e r c i s i n g a n e g a t i v e i n f l u e n c e o n t h e e x p e n d i t u r e s g r o u p s . Instead, t h e G e r ­ m a n s i t u a t i o n a p p e a r s r a t h e r b a l a n c e d .

T h e t h r e e v a r i a b l e sets a r e c l e a r l y n o t l e v e l - s p e c i f i c a l l y i n ­ d i f f e r e n t w i t h r e s p e c t to t h e i r i m p a c t o n t h e s u b s t i t u t i o n e f ­ fects. It is here, n e v e r t h e l e s s , a t t e m p t e d to c a t e g o r i z e the e x p e n d i t u r e gro u p s , r e g a r d l e s s of t h e i r g o v e r n m e n t a l level,

a c c o r d i n g t o t h e i m p a c t of the d o m i n a t i n g s i n g l e v a r i a b l e s .

H ereby, t h e a g g r e g a t e g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l is i g n o r e d , s i n c e it c a n ­ n o t b e c o n s i d e r e d as in i n d e p e n d e n t a u t h o r i t y in the d e c i s i o n m a k i n g p r o c e s s . O n l y .the e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r y d e f e n s e is almost ex­

c l u s i v e l y d o m i n a t e d b y i n s t i t u t i o n a l factors; p r e d o m i n a n t l y i n ­ s t i t u t i o n a l l y i n f l u e n c e d - at l e a s t at t w o g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l s - are s e v e r a l e x p e n d i t u r e s gro u p s , for e x a m p l e , t h e e x p e n d i t u r e s for e c o n o m i c d e v e l o p m e n t , p u b l i c f i n a n c e m a n a g e m e n t , u n i v e r s i t i e s ,

(25)

m e d i c a r e , e n v i r o n m e n t a l p r o t e c t i o n a n d p u b l i c e n t e r p r i s e s . T h e r e ­ fore, a p p r o x i m a t e l y 54% of t h e e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r i e s are m a i n l y i n f l u e n c e d b y i n s t i t u t i o n a l f a c t o r s . N o e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p c a n be i d e n t i f i e d as e x c l u s i v e l y or a l m o s t e x c l u s i v e l y p o l i t i c a l l y d o m i n a t e d .

T h e e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s of p u b l i c safety, p u b l i c s c h o o l s y s ­ t e m a n d m i s c e l l a n e o u s are i n f l u e n c e d p r e d o m i n a n t l y b y s o c i o - e c o ­ n o m i c f a c t o r s , w h i l e s o c i a l w e l f a r e and t r a n s p o r t a t i o n a r e d e ­ t e r m i n e d e x c l u s i v e l y b y t h e s e f a c t o r s . In sum, a p p r o x i m a t e l y 38%

of t h e e x p e n d i t u r e s g r o u p s a r e m a i n l y i n f l u e n c e d b y socio-econctnic variables. If these r e s u l t s are f u r t h e r c o m p a r e d w i t h t h e r e s u l t s of

the l o n g - r u n s u b s t i t u t i o n p r o c e s s e s , t h e n the D a v i s / D e m p s t e r / W i l - d a v s k y ' s s c e p t i c i s m c o n c e r n i n g t h e i m p o r t a n c e of t h e s o c i o - e c o n o ­ m i c f a c t o r s c a n n o t be s u p p o r t e d . T h e e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r i e s w i t h t h e h i g h e s t s u b s t i t u t i o n g a i n s (e.g., s o c i a l w e l f a r e , p u b l i c e d u ­ cation) are c o m p l e t e l y or a l m o s t c o m p l e t e l y i n f l u e n c e d by s o c i o ­ e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s , w h i l e t h e e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s w i t h the h i g h e s t s u b s t i t u t i o n l o s s e s (e.g., d e f e n s e , e c o n o m i c d e v e l o p m e n t ) are

m a i n l y i n f l u e n c e d b y i n s t i t u t i o n a l factors. It d o e s n o t a p p e a r t o b e p l a u s i b l e t h a t i n s t i t u t i o n a l d e p e n d e n c e w i l l n e c e s s a r i l y l e a d to s u b s t i t u t i o n g a i n s or at l e a s t s t r u c t u r a l s t a b i l i t y , b u t r a t h e r i n c r e m e n t a l b u d g e t i n g m a y i n s t e a d c a u s e s u b s t a n t i a l s t r u c t u r a l l o s s e s - a l o n g - r u n a s p e c t w h i c h the i n c r e m e n t a l i s t s , d u e to t h e i r f i x a t i o n on t h e s h o r t p e r i o d h a v e f r e q u e n t l y igno r e d . O n t h e o t h e r h a n d , o n e m a y a g r e e w i t h D a v i s / D e m p s t e r / W i l d a v s k y 1s c o n c l u s i o n

(1974, p. 451) t h a t s o c i o - e c o n o m i c v a r i a b l e s h a v e a p a r t i c u l a r l y i m p o r t a n t i m p a c t on " n o n - c o n t r o v e r s i a l - a c t i v i t i e s " . In th i s study, s u c h " n o n - c o n t r o v e r s i a l a c t i v i t i e s " i n c l u d e s o c i a l w e l f a r e a n d p u b l i c e d u c a t i o n , as w e l l as t h e c a t e g o r i e s " m i s c e l l a n e o u s "

(26)

(including a d m i n i s t r a t i o n , f i n e arts, cult u r e , f o r e i g n a f f a i r s , f o r e i g n aid) a n d p u b l i c s afety, w h i c h o b t a i n e d the l a r g e s t s u b ­ s t i t u t i o n g ains. T h e e x p e n d i t u r e s for t r a n s p o r t a t i o n , w h i c h on a l l g o v e r n m e n t a l l e v e l s w e r e p r i m a r i l y e x p l a i n e d b y s o c i o - e c o ­ n o m i c v a r i a b l e s , a p p a r e n t l y d i d n o t b e l o n g to the " n o n - c o n t r o - v e r s i a l " - c a t e g o r y . H e r e a n d in t h e ca s e of p u b l i c h o u s i n g , the D a v i s / D e m p s t e r / W i l d a v s k y 1s h y p o t h e s i s m a y b e c o r r e c t , n a m e l y tha t n o n - i n s t i t u t i o n a l f a c t o r s m a i n l y a f f e c t t h e " v u l n e r a b l e " e x p e n d i ­ t u r e gro u p s . E x p e n d i t u r e s m a y b e v i e w e d v u l n e r a b l e , if t h e y o f ­ f e r " r o u t i n e - s e r v i c e s " , for e x a m p l e p u b l i c h o u s i n g o r if t h e y a r e o b j e c t of p u b l i c d i s p u t e ( t r a n s p o r t a t i o n , esp. h i g h w a y s ) .

T h e e x p e n d i t u r e g r o u p s w i t h m o d e r a t e s u b s t i t u t i o n gains,

s u c h as p u b l i c f i n a n c e m a n a g e m e n t , u n i v e r s i t i e s , m e d i c a r e , e n v i r o n ­ m e n t a l p r o t e c t i o n a n d p u b l i c e c o n o m i c e n t e r p r i s e s , i l l u s t r a t e t h a t p r e d o m i n a n t l y i n s t i t u t i o n a l d e t e r m i n a t i o n and, t h e r e f o r e , i n c r e ­ m e n t a l b u d g e t i n g b e h a v i o r w i l l be r e f l e c t e d in m o d e r a t e e x p a n s i o n of c e r t a i n e x p e n d i t u r e c a t e g o r i e s . Th i s is the n o r m a l s i t u a t i o n as t h e p r o p o n e n t s o f i n c r e m e n t a l i s m w o u l d t y p i c a l l y p r e d i c t .
